Handover for the Tarnwick cache layer. The bloom filter sits in front of the Ochre KV store and cuts miss traffic by ~90%. False-positive rate is tuned to 1%; don't shrink the bitset without re-running the sizing script. Rebuild the filter after any bulk delete, or stale positives pile up. Review PRs touching the hasher carefully. Rebuilds need access to the seed vault, which unlocks with the recovery passphrase below.

strongbox words: sorir-belvan-rusix-ulays-ralmir-praix-eliir-tamax-praael-druael-julir-tamius-jorir

## Runbook: Sweepline Retention Sweeper

Plugin authors: Sweepline purges expired records nightly. Your plugin's delete hooks must be idempotent; the sweeper retries failed batches twice before quarantining. Do not hold locks longer than 30 seconds or the batch aborts. Dry-run mode is available per tenant for validation. Register hooks via the Pellwood manifest, not at runtime. Before testing against staging, confirm your hook timeouts against the active configuration values, which are listed below.

deployment values, yadug-bawif:
[framir]
team = pelox
access_code = ac_a38ab2
owner = tamion.julael
host = framir.tolvaqlabs.test
port = 11211
peer = tammir.zemvargrid.local
salt = 2215ef03
pin = 1541

Handover — Pagination on the Fernwick public API

Hey, quick brain-dump before I'm out. The v2 endpoints use cursor pagination; v1 is still offset-based and we're deprecating it next quarter. Cursors are opaque, don't let partners parse them — we've had two do it anyway. The page-size cap is 200, enforced at the gateway. Open item: cursors expire too aggressively on the search endpoint. Going forward, questions about pagination go to the person below.

named custodian: Brivan Eliath Quenox Frador

Facilities ticket — Halewick Tower, night shift.

Issue: support team reporting east stairwell reader rejecting badges after midnight. Reader was reset this morning; firmware updated. Overnight crew should now badge as normal. If the reader fails again, use the manual keypad by the fire door — do not prop the door. Log any further failures with the time and badge name. Temporary keypad code for the fallback door is below.

door code, tajeg-fawip: bdg-K-62